The Administrative Officer is responsible for establishing and managing the day-to-day administrative operations of the Country Office in Cambodia, ensuring efficient office management and compliance with organizational policies and local regulations. The role provides administrative, logistical, financial, procurement, and HR support to facilitate smooth office and programme operations.
Core Focus
This position combines office administration, logistics coordination, finance administration, procurement, HR administration, and office operations management to ensure the Country Office functions efficiently and in compliance with organizational standards.
- Office Establishment & Administration: Support the setup and operation of the Country Office, including office registration, compliance, facilities management, procurement of office equipment, and maintaining administrative systems.
- Office Operations & Logistics: Manage reception, correspondence, filing systems, travel arrangements, meetings, workshops, office supplies, inventories, contracts, visas, work permits, and vehicle administration.
- Administrative Support: Record meeting minutes and provide translation (Khmer–English) when required.
- Finance Support: Assist with petty cash, bank transactions, payment processing, accounting documentation, and programme bank account administration.
- Procurement: Coordinate and manage low-value procurement activities, ensuring compliance with procurement policies and maintaining complete procurement documentation.
- Human Resources Support: Coordinate with the regional HR team, manage leave and overtime records for support staff, and supervise the Driver and Logistics Assistant, including performance management.
- Stakeholder Coordination: Maintain effective communication with government authorities, service providers, banks, internal teams, and regional offices to support administrative operations.
- Other Duties: Provide administrative support to programmes and perform additional tasks assigned by the supervisor.
